  5. Any person who seeks to contest the election of directors shall, whether he is a retiring director or otherwise, file with the Company, the following documents and information at its registered office not later than fourteen days before the date of the above said meeting:
    a). His/her Folio No./ CDC Investor Account No. /CDC Participant No./ Sub-Account No. The qualification of a director shall be his/her holding shares in the Company of the nominal value of Rs.10,000 in terms of Article 52 of the Articles of Association;
    b). Notice of his/her intention to offer himself/herself for the election of directors in terms of section 159 of the Companies Act, 2017.
    c). Information on Annexure A, along with the attachments required therein, and Affidavit on Annexure B required under Insurance Companies (Sound and Prudent Management) Regulations, 2012 notified by the Securities and Exchange Commission of Pakistan (SECP) vide S.R.O 15(1) of 2012 dated January 09, 2012. Annexure A and Annexure B are available on SECP's website (www.secp.gov.pk), website of the Company (www.habibinsurance.net) and can also be obtained from the Registered Office of the Company; 1st Floor, State Life Building No.6, Habib Square, M.A. Jinnah Road, Karachi.

Habib Insurance Company Limited

d). Affidavit on Annexure C required under S.R.O 1165(I) of 2016 dated December 22, 2016. The affidavit is available on Company's website and S.R.O 1165 is available on SECP's website.

e). Undertaking on Annexure A required under direction issued vide S.R.O 1525(1) of 2018 dated December 14, 2018.The undertaking is available on Company's website and S.R.O 1525 is available on SECP's website.

f). Consent to act as director on Form 28 under section 167 of the Companies Act, 2017.

g). A detailed profile alongwith his/her office address as required under SECP's S.R.O 634(1) of 2014 dated July 10, 2014 for placing on website of the Company.

h). An attested copy of Computerized National Identity Card (CNIC or NICOP).

i). A declaration that:

• He/She is not ineligible to become a director of the Company under section 153 of the Companies Act, 2017.

  • He/She is not serving as a director of more than seven listed companies.
  • He/She is aware of his/her duties and powers under the relevant laws, Memorandum & Article of Association of Company and Listing Regulations of Pakistan Stock Exchange.

j). Please note that as per Regulation 2(2) of the Insurance Companies (Sound and Prudent Management) Regulations, 2012, proposed directors shall not assume the charge of office until their appointment has been approved by the SECP. The above information is required by the SECP for approval of the proposed directors and any other supporting information to evaluate the proposed director's fitness and propriety.
